Can I live in Delhi on $1,000/month?
Living in Delhi on $1,000/mo is rated "Comfortable". Budget allocates ~$512 to rent, $195 to groceries, $133 to dining.
Can I live in Monterrey on $1,000/month?
In Monterrey, $1,000/mo is rated "Moderate". Allocations: $519 rent, $215 groceries, $115 dining.
Is Delhi or Monterrey cheaper?
Delhi is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Delhi 20.6 vs Monterrey 25.9 (NYC=100).
What is $1,000/mo in Delhi worth in Monterrey?
$1,000/mo of purchasing power in Delhi equals ~$1,257/mo in Monterrey using COL adjustment.
